Ron Willis, host of “This Week in Politics with Dr. Ron Willis” is a native Californian who began his professional career 1965 as a Southern Baptist Minister with churches in Oakland, CA; Bangor, Maine, and San Antonio, TX. In 1979 Ron moved to Washington DC to serve as Senior Staff Associate to Congressman Ron Dellums (ret). In 1993 he became Chief Lobbyist for The George Washington University. Juan has been a journalist for 17 years and has covered two World Cups and four Copa Americas. He has also worked as a commentator on ESPN, beIN Sports, Eurosport covering various leagues from around the world. He's also a writer for sites like Al-Jazeera Sport, The Telegraph and SPORT amongst others as well as a frequent guest on networks like BBC, TALKSport, SportsMax.
